Understanding Common Challenges in Indoor Cannabis Cultivation


Indoor cannabis cultivation offers growers the advantage of controlling environmental conditions to achieve optimal plant growth. However, like all forms of agriculture, it comes with its set of challenges. Understanding these common obstacles is the first step towards a thriving garden.

Environmental Control

One of the primary challenges in indoor cultivation is maintaining the perfect environment. Factors such as temperature, humidity, and ventilation can significantly affect plant health. Maintaining consistent conditions can be particularly difficult, especially for novice growers.

Nutrient Management

Another significant challenge is ensuring your plants receive the proper nutrients at the right stages. Over or under-fertilizing can severely impact the quality and yield of your crop.

Watering Techniques

Watering can also present challenges, as both overwatering and underwatering can lead to plant stress. Ensuring an even distribution of water is key to healthy plant development.

Monitoring and Measuring

Accurate monitoring and measurement are critical to address any issues that arise in cultivation. Misjudging water pH levels or nutrient concentrations can result in poor growth.
